Class 10 The Midnight Visitor Questions Answers

NCERT Class 10 English – Footprints Without Feet – Chapter 3: The Midnight Visitor

Exercise Questions: Short Answers & Simple Explanations

Q1. How is Ausable different from other secret agents?

Answer: Ausable is fat, slow-moving, and speaks calmly, unlike typical fit and stylish agents.

Explanation: Most agents are shown as strong and smartly dressed, but Ausable is ordinary in appearance and uses his mind more than physical action.

Q2. Who is Fowler and what is his first authentic thrill of the day?

Answer: Fowler is a young writer. His thrill comes when he sees a man with a pistol in Ausable’s room.

Explanation: Fowler expected excitement but got it unexpectedly when Max appeared with a gun.

Q3. How has Max got in?

Answer: Max says he entered through the balcony.

Explanation: He used the balcony outside Ausable’s room as his entry point.

Q4. How does Ausable say he got in?

Answer: Ausable also says Max entered through the balcony.

Explanation: He supports Max’s claim to make him believe in the balcony’s existence.

Q5. “Ausable did not fit any description of a secret agent Fowler had ever read.” What do secret agents in books and films look like, in your opinion?

Answer: They are usually tall, fit, well-dressed, and confident.

Explanation: In films and books, agents like James Bond or Sherlock Holmes are stylish and physically active, unlike Ausable.

Q6. How does Ausable manage to make Max believe that there is a balcony attached to his room?

Answer: He describes it in detail and says it is used for breaking in before.

Explanation: His calm tone and believable details convince Max that the balcony exists.

Q7. Looking back at the story, when do you think Ausable thought up his plan for getting rid of Max?

Answer: He planned it instantly after seeing Max.

Explanation: Ausable used quick thinking and took advantage of the situation as events happened.
